Kampala MPs shun mayoral by-election

Kampala Members of Parliament have decided to shun city mayoral by-election.

This comes days after the Electoral Commission announced 17th of April as the polling date.

Led by Kawempe North MP Latiff Ssebaggala, the legislators say the whole process is against the law with the embattled Lord Mayor Erias Lukwago is still in court over a petition in which he seeks to retain his seat.

Ssebaggala advises the Electoral Commission to get legal experts to help in interpreting the law to avoid such discrepancies.

The MPs’ move follows a similar decision by the opposition Forum for Democratic Party which announced that it would not field any candidate in the controversial mayoral race.

The Lord Mayor Erias Lukwago was impeached by a group of councilors following a KCCA tribunal report that found him guilty of incompetence.
